What is an HDMI Card?

An HDMI card, also known as an HDMI capture card, is a piece of peripheral equipment that helps a user capture the audio and video signal of an HDMI source, such as a camera, gaming console, computer, etc., and stream or record the captured content on another device.

Mostly, to broadcast events live, stream live, or for the purpose of game capture, HDMI cards are used.

The HDMI cards work by receiving the signal in the form of HDMI input, converting it to a computer-readable format and forwarding the signal to the recording or streaming software.

These are the very HDMI cards that are necessary for every gamer, broadcaster, or content creator who wishes to live stream his/her quality video content.

Types of HDMI Cards

Internal HDMI Cards: Such cards are placed into a computer through pre-designed PCIe slots and can provide both high-level performance as well as low latency.

External HDMI Cards: These also work over USB or Thunderbolt ports and, therefore, do not need any internal installation.

4K HDMI Cards: These cards can stream and capture video in up to 4K resolution for your content in high definition.

1080p HDMI Cards: These are built particularly for seamless streaming and recording with a full high-definition 1080p resolution size, thus perfect for any one of the standard content-creation requirements.

Multi-Input HDMI Cards: These cards have more than one HDMI input port, enabling simultaneous video capture from multiple sources.

How to Use an Adapter for Making the Most out of HDMI?

In case If you think that upgrading a desktop and meddling with PC components is a cumbersome process, there is another way out. You can enjoy an HDMI display by using an HDMI adapter. Let us say your old PC has an analog signal. This means that it depends on a VGA – a 3-rowed and 15-pin analog connector which that does not give an audio output and renders mediocre video quality. If you want a digital HDMI format for HDMI display, you can convert your desktop’s VGA signal into HDMI format.

FAQs:

1. How do I add an HDMI port to a laptop?

You can use a USB-to-HDMI adapter or a docking station with HDMI output to add an HDMI port to a laptop. These peripherals connect to a laptop's USB port and provide an HDMI output for external displays. Ensure your laptop's USB port supports the required data transfer rate for video output.

2. How do I know which version of the HDMI port I have on my laptop?

You can determine your laptop's HDMI version by checking the manufacturer's specifications or user manual or by looking for markings on the HDMI port itself. Some software tools can also identify hardware details, including the HDMI version. Alternatively, you can contact the laptop manufacturer for precise information.

3. Is it possible to add an HDMI port to a computer that doesn't have one? Is it ever a wise thing to do?

Adding an HDMI port to a computer without one is possible using a USB-to-HDMI adapter or a dedicated graphics card with HDMI output. It's a practical solution if you need to connect to modern displays or projectors. Ensure the chosen adapter or graphics card is compatible with your computer's specifications and operating system.

4. What are the types of HDMI ports available on PCs?

PCs can have various types of HDMI ports, including Standard HDMI (Type A), Mini HDMI (Type C), and Micro HDMI (Type D). The most common type on PCs is the Standard HDMI port. Each type varies in size and is suitable for different devices and use cases.

5. Can I use multiple monitors with HDMI ports on my PC?

Using multiple monitors with HDMI ports on your PC is feasible by utilizing multiple HDMI outputs available on your graphics card or using HDMI splitters. Modern graphics cards often support several HDMI outputs, allowing for an extended desktop setup. Ensure your PC's hardware supports the desired multi-monitor configuration for optimal performance.
